Transaction ffa6eedbad560264020d6bf745ea7a209ca82bbf093285852819ebfa800ec9b5
1 Input
1 Output
-
ffa6eedbad560264020d6bf745ea7a209ca82bbf093285852819ebfa800ec9b5:0
- value
- 17172583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3b60947fcf83e48665b8600295605b21cbf8ea3 OP_EQUAL
- address
- MRjz4wM84XqmTcJiJGPGPKKmvS67HDbQ6h